Options for Change
Options for Change was a restructuring of the British Armed Forces in 1990 after the end of the Cold War.

Queen's Own Cameron Highlanders
The Queen's Own Cameron Highlanders or 79th (The Queen's Own Cameron Highlanders) Regiment of Foot was a line infantry regiment of the British Army, raised in 1793.
